1.1 GENERAL NOTES FOR SERVICING
(1) Before trying to disassemble the ScanCopier, make sure the power supply code of the ScanCopier
is disconnected from the power outlet. Under any circumstance, do not remove from or install the
PWBs or connectors onto the ScanCopier with the power supply turned ON.
(2) Use caution not to drop small parts or screws inside the unit when disassembling and
reassembling. If left inside, they might cause the malfunction of the unit.
(3) Do not pull the connector cable when disconnecting it. Hold the connector.
(4) When carrying PWBs or the scanning head unit, put it in an anti-static bag.
(5) Keep the document table glass surface always clean. If contaminated, use a dry clean cloth for
cleaning.
(6) Use caution not to injure your fingers or hands when disassembling or reassembling the unit.

1.3 COPY FEATURES
(1) A Compact and light weight copier
With only 3.7 kgs and a small foot print few inches more than an A4 page, ScanCopier is easy and
convenient to transport and relocate to fit your ever changing requirement.
(2) Ease of Use
The control panel on the front of ScanCopier looks like a panel on a regular copier. The operating
steps follow the same procedure as other regular copier.
(3) Auto photo and text separation
Incorporated with the dialogic processor, a mixed photo and text original could reproduce a clear
detail of photo image.
(4) Clear image of three dimensional object
Based on the CCD technology, ScanCopier could break through the limit of two dimensions, and
produce a clear image for a three dimensional object.
(5) Reduction or enlargement from 25% to 400%
ScanCopier provides reduction or enlargement for your original from 25% to 400%. You can access
the feature through the preset ratio or in 1% increment.
(6) Auto background removal
If your original comes with background, you can reproduce a clear image by removing the
background using the feature.
(7) A full color copier if connects to a host computer
When ScanCopier is connected to a host computer and a color printer, your ScanCopier is possessed
of a full color copy capability.

2. SPECIFICATION
2.1 Basic Specification
2.1 BASIC SPECIFICATION
Product Name: ScanCopier
ScanCopier Type: Flatbed
Optical Resolution 300 x 600 dpi
Scanning Mode 30-bit Color (Internal)
10-bit Gray (Internal)
Copy Resolution up to 600 x 600 dpi
Copy Speed 20 ppm (if connect to a 20 ppm laser printer)
Scanning (Copying) Size 8.5” x 14”
Interface IEEE 1284 (bi-directional)
ECP/EPP/SPP
Copy Feature Zooming From 25%~400%
Auto Zooming
Auto Background Removal
Auto Photo, Text Separation
Power Consumption 15 watts
Photoelectric device Color CCD
Light Source Cold Cathode Fluorescent Lamp
Push Button Equipped
LED 1 LED (power)
Rated Voltage AC100-120V
Frequency Range 50-60Hz
Physical Dimension 356 mm x 457 mm x 91 mm(WxHxD)
Rated Current 1.25A/12V
Weight 3.7 kg (8.1 lbs)

3.1 PRECAUTIONS OF INSTALLATION
Pay attention to the following matters before unpacking and installation.
•Do not install in a place where vibration may occur.
•Keep the ScanCopier out of direct sunlight. Do not install near a heat source.
•Do not place the ScanCopier around materials which shut off the circulation of air.
•Do not install in a humid or dusty place.
•Use care not to scratch the glass surface of the ScanCopier or the document holding pad
with a clip or staple.
•Do not use the wall socket with connecting devices which may generate noise, for example,
air-conditioner, etc.
•Use a suitable AC power source.
•Place the ScanCopier on a level surface.
3.2 UNPACKING PROCEDURE
Unpack the ScanCopier according to the following procedure.
•Remove the packing material.
•Remove the ScanCopier from the shipping container.
•Remove the ScanCopier from the PVC bag.
•Check the items by referring to Figure 3.1.
•For any missing items, please contact your nearest dealer or distributor.
Note: Keep all the packing material in case you may need to return the ScanCopier.

3.3 INSTALLATION
(1). Unlocking the ScanCopier
Before you use ScanCopier, be sure to unlock it by moving the lock switch under the ScanCopier to the
“Unlock” position(See the following figure). The lock switch is designed to protect the scanning head in
case of any damage during shipment.
12
Figure 3.2 Unlock the ScanCopier
Note: If you need to transport the ScanCopier, be sure to first move the lock switch to the “Lock”
position to prevent any damage during transportation.

(2). Connecting to a laser printer
a) Plug one end of the printer cable to the port marked “to printer” on the back of your
ScanCopier.
b) Plug the other end to your printer. (See the Figure 3.3)
Figure 3.3 Connecting to a laser printer
(3). Connecting to Power
a) Plug the small end of the power cable(supplied) to the power jack on the back of your
ScanCopier.
b) Plug the large end of the power cable to the power outlet.
c) Turn on your printer.

(4). Connecting to a host computer
a) Remove the printer cable from the parallel port of your computer and plug it into the port
marked “To printer” on the back of the ScanCopier. Leave the other end connected to your
printer.
b) Plug one end of the supplied parallel cable to the port marked “To PC Parallel” on the back
of the ScanCopier and plug the other end into your PC where the printer port cable was
plugging in.
Figure 3.5 ScanCopier cable connection
3.4 PLACING THE ORIGINAL
(1) Place your original face down on the document glass.
(2) Observe that the upper-left corner (front page) of your original is placed beneath the home
position mark.
